Riot Blockchain Announces October Production and Operations Updates
November 3, 2021 8:30 AM EDTCastle Rock, CO, Nov. 03, 2021 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Riot Blockchain, Inc. (NASDAQ: RIOT) (Riot, Riot Blockchain or the Company), an industry leader in Bitcoin (BTC) mining and hosting, announces monthly BTC production and operations updates for October 2021, including an increase in estimated self-mining hash rate capacity for 2022, updates to the status of miner shipments and deployment, and updates on the 400 megawatts (MW) infrastructure expansion at the Companys Whinstone facility (Whinstone).
Production Updates
